import { K8sResource, ResourceRef } from "@k8ts/instruments"; import { K8S } from "@k8ts/sample-interfaces"; import { Pvc } from "../../.."; import { Service } from "../../network"; import { Pod } from "../pod/pod"; import type { Workload_Ref } from "../workload-ref"; import type { StatefulSet_Props } from "./props"; export declare class StatefulSet = Ports> extends K8sResource> implements Workload_Ref { private readonly _template; readonly Service: Service; get kind(): import("@k8ts/instruments").Gvk<"apps/v1/StatefulSet">; protected __needs__(): Record; get selectorLabels(): import("@k8ts/metadata").Metadata; private _podTemplate; protected __kids__(): Iterable; protected __body__(): Promise; private get _updateStrategy(); get PodTemplate(): Pod; get PvcTemplates(): Iterable>; get ports(): import("@k8ts/instruments").PortExports; } //# sourceMappingURL=statefulset.d.ts.map